I have no synths.. should I?

A relatively new install of Music Creator 3 that I am just getting up to speed on... the manual says I should have some DirectX synths included. It says Dreamstation and VSC.. I don't have them nor do I see a separatre install for them on the CD.. am I missing something?

    Did you run the VST adapter when you installed? it would have asked if you wanted to do so when it started up. it scans for the VSTis and DXis in the locations provided and the default locations, but if you didn't run it then it won't find them and they won't be available to you. you can always run it anytime - I don't remember the menu option, or you can run it from your WINDOWS START PROGRAMS under CAKEWALK. after you run it, you have to close MC then reopen before you can see the VSTis and DXis.
